Tax Filing Requirements for Nonprofit Organizations

Nonprofit organizations are exempt from paying federal income tax, but they are still required to file annual tax returns with the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). The specific tax form that a nonprofit organization is required to file depends on its size and type of activities.

Which tax form to file

Most nonprofit organizations are required to file Form 990, Return of Organization Exempt from Income Tax. However, there are a few exceptions:

  • Form 990-EZ: Small nonprofit organizations with annual gross receipts of less than $200,000 and total assets of less than $500,000 may be eligible to file Form 990-EZ, Short Form Return of Organization Exempt from Income Tax.
  • Form 990-N: Nonprofit organizations with annual gross receipts of less than $50,000 may be eligible to file Form 990-N, Electronic Notice (e-Postcard) for Tax-Exempt Organizations Not Required To File Form 990 or Form 990-EZ.

Tax Filing Requirements of Nonprofit Organizations: When to file

Nonprofit organizations are required to file their annual tax return by the 15th day of the fifth month after the close of their fiscal year. For example, a nonprofit organization with a fiscal year ending on December 31 would be required to file its tax return by May 15.

Tax filing implications

Aside from the tax filing requirements for nonprofit organizations, there are a number of tax filing implications that go along with these requirements. First, nonprofit organizations that fail to file a tax return on time may be subject to penalties. Second, nonprofit organizations that file a false or fraudulent tax return may be subject to criminal penalties. Third, nonprofit organizations that fail to file a tax return for three consecutive years may automatically lose their tax-exempt status. This means that they would be required to pay income tax on their future earnings.



Organizers and founders of nonprofits should also be aware of the following additional tax filing requirements for nonprofit organizations:

  • Public disclosure: Form 990 and Form 990-EZ are public records, which means that anyone can access them online.
  • Transparency: Nonprofit organizations are required to disclose certain information on their tax returns, such as their financial statements, board member compensation, and lobbying activities.
  • Accuracy: Nonprofit organizations are required to file accurate and complete tax returns.

Conclusion

Tax filing can be a complex process for nonprofit organizations. It is important for nonprofit organizations to understand their tax filing requirements and to comply with all applicable laws and regulations.

Here are some additional tips for nonprofit organizations on tax filing:

  • Start early: Don’t wait until the last minute to start preparing your tax return. Give yourself plenty of time to gather all of the necessary information and to complete the form accurately.
  • Keep good records: It is important to keep good financial records throughout the year. This will make it easier to prepare your tax return and to support your claims with documentation.
  • Get help from a professional: If you are unsure about how to file your tax return, you may want to consider getting help from a professional tax accountant or attorney.

By following these tips, nonprofit organizations can ensure that they are complying with their tax filing requirements. This will help them to avoid penalties and to maintain their tax-exempt status.
